Understanding the Cost of Painting a Car

The cost of painting a car can vary greatly, depending on several factors such as the size of the car, the type of paint used, and the location where the painting is done. On average, the cost of painting a car can range from $500 to $5,000 or more. In this section, we will break down the different factors that affect the cost of painting process.

Size of the Car

The size of the car is one of the most significant factors that affect the cost of painting. Larger cars require more paint, which means higher costs. Here is a rough estimate of the cost of painting a car based on its size:

  • Small cars (e.g., Toyota Yaris, Honda Fit): $500-$1,500
  • Mid-size cars (e.g., Toyota Camry, Honda Accord): $1,000-$3,000
  • Large cars (e.g., Ford Taurus, Chevrolet Impala): $1,500-$4,000
  • SUVs and trucks (e.g., Honda CR-V, Ford F-150): $2,000-$5,000

Location

The location where the painting is done can also affect the cost. Paint shops in urban areas tend to be more expensive than those in rural areas. Here is a rough estimate of the cost of painting a car based on the location:

  • Urban areas: $1,000-$3,000
  • Rural areas: $500-$1,500

Challenges of Painting a Car Black

While painting a car black can have several benefits, it also comes with some challenges. In this section, we will explore the potential drawbacks of painting a car black.

Heat Absorption

Black paint can absorb heat, which can increase the temperature inside the car. This can be uncomfortable for passengers and can also increase the risk of heatstroke.

Fading and Discoloration

Black paint can also be prone to fading and discoloration, especially when exposed to direct sunlight. This can reduce the appearance of the car and require more frequent touch-ups.

Q: How long does it take to paint a car?

The time it takes to paint a car can vary depending on the size of the car, the type of paint used, and the location where the painting is done. On average, it can take around 1-3 days to paint a car.

Q: How much does it cost to touch up a paint job?

The cost of touching up a paint job can vary depending on the extent of the damage. On average, it can cost around $100-$500 to touch up a paint job.
